For episode #81 of Sundays with SEEMA, our founder, Seema Kumar, sits down with Kavita Mehra, Executive Director of Sakhi for South Asian Women, an organization that supports survivors of gender-based violence. She talks to us about Sakhi and what initially drew her to the organization, and discusses her experience growing up in a working-class community and how it led to her career in advocacy and community service.
Sundays with SEEMA is a television and broadcast series featuring remarkable stories of South Asian women who are pushing today’s limits and breaking tomorrow’s boundaries, broadcast on TV Asia, and on SEEMA TV.
